02

Hazard Identification

GHS classification, signal word, pictograms, and hazard statements

Classified danger

Hazard Classifications

Flam. Liq. Cat. 3 H226
Acute Tox. Cat. 4 H302
Skin Corr. Cat. 1 H314
STOT SE Cat. 2 H371

GHS Pictograms

GHS02 - Flammable

GHS02

GHS05 - Corrosive

GHS05

GHS07 - Health hazard

GHS07

GHS08 - Serious health hazard

GHS08

Hazard Statements

H226 Flammable liquid and vapour.
H302 Harmful if swallowed.
H314 Causes severe skin burns and eye damage.
H371 May cause damage to organs.

Precautionary Statements

P210 Keep away from heat, hot surfaces, sparks, open flames and other ignition sources. No smoking.
P264 Wash hands, forearms and face thoroughly after handling.
P280 Wear protective gloves/protective clothing/eye protection/face protection/hearing protection.
P301 + P330 + P331 + P310 IF SWALLOWED: rinse mouth. Do NOT induce vomiting. Immediately call a POISON CENTER or doctor.
P303 + P361 + P353 + P310 IF ON SKIN (or hair): Take off immediately all contaminated clothing. Rinse skin with water/shower. Immediately call a POISON CENTER or doctor.
P305 + P351 + P338 + P310 IF IN EYES: Rinse cautiously with water for several minutes. Remove contact lenses, if present and easy to do. Continue rinsing. Immediately call a POISON CENTER or doctor.

03

Composition / Information on Ingredients

Chemical components, concentration ranges, and hazardous substance identification

Type mixture
Chemical Name CAS Number Concentration Hazardous
Water - INCI:Aqua EC: 231-791-2 7732-18-5 80.1% No
Potassium hydroxide pellets EC: 215-181-3 1310-58-3 12% Yes
Methylalcohol 67-56-1 4% Yes
Acetone EC: 200-662-2 67-64-1 1% Yes
Isomesityloxide 3744-02-3 1% Yes
mono-methylamine EC: 200-820-0 74-89-5 1% Yes
Toluene EC: 203-625-9 108-88-3 0.2% Yes
Mesityl oxide EC: 205-502-5 141-79-7 0.2% Yes
Palladium metaal EC: 231-115-6 7440-05-3 0.045 - 0.1% No
04

First Aid Measures

Emergency procedures for chemical exposure incidents

Inhalation

Remove person to fresh air and keep comfortable for breathing. Place the victim in semi-seated position. Give oxygen or artificial respiration as needed. Call a poison center or a doctor if you feel unwell.

Symptoms: Effects of breathing dust are not investigated. Avoid inhaling this material.

Skin contact

Take off immediately all contaminated clothing. Flush with lukewarm water for 15 minutes. Seek medical attention if ill effect or irritation develops.

Symptoms: Causes burns.

Eye contact

Flush with lukewarm water for 15 minutes. Seek medical attention if ill effect or irritation develops.

Symptoms: Causes serious eye damage.

Ingestion

Do not induce vomiting. Rinse mouth. Call a poison center or a doctor if you feel unwell.

Symptoms: Burns or irritation of the linings of the mouth, throat, and gastrointestinal tract.

Immediate Medical Attention

Contact ophthalmologist immediately.

Medical Treatment

Treat symptomatically.

14

Transport Information

UN numbers, shipping names, transport classes, and regulatory requirements

UN Number
1760
Shipping Name
CORROSIVE LIQUID, N.O.S.
Transport Class
8
Packing Group
II
ADR

Packing instructions (ADR) : P001, IBC02; Mixed packing provisions (ADR) : MP15; Portable tank and bulk container instructions (ADR) : T11; Portable tank and bulk container special provisions (ADR) : TP2, TP27; Tank code (ADR) : L4BN; Vehicle for tank carriage : AT; EAC code : 2X

IMDG

Stowage category (IMDG) : B; Stowage and handling (IMDG) : SW2; Properties and observations (IMDG) : Causes burns to skin, eyes and mucous membranes.

IATA

PCA Excepted quantities (IATA) : E2; PCA Limited quantities (IATA) : Y840; PCA limited quantity max net quantity (IATA) : 0.5L; PCA packing instructions (IATA) : 851; PCA max net quantity (IATA) : 1L; CAO packing instructions (IATA) : 855; CAO max net quantity (IATA) : 30L; ERG code (IATA) : 8L
